about summary refs log tree commit diff
path: root/app/mailers
diff options
context:
space:
mode:
authorabcang <abcang1015@gmail.com>2018-02-04 20:31:46 +0900
committerEugen Rochko <eugen@zeonfederated.com>2018-02-04 12:31:46 +0100
commitc156a83e7d4458355e7ab60ee118ca8c09b80ece (patch)
tree2d9bd61067f6baaf5222596572f2756ea144920f /app/mailers
parent258dcb849f2146069a2b2914cea3a28619f55c90 (diff)
Make sure status is not nil (#6428)
Diffstat (limited to 'app/mailers')
-rw-r--r--app/mailers/notification_mailer.rb6
1 files changed, 3 insertions, 3 deletions
diff --git a/app/mailers/notification_mailer.rb b/app/mailers/notification_mailer.rb
index 9fed4a636..b45844296 100644
--- a/app/mailers/notification_mailer.rb
+++ b/app/mailers/notification_mailer.rb
@@ -9,7 +9,7 @@ class NotificationMailer < ApplicationMailer
     @me     = recipient
     @status = notification.target_status
 
-    return if @me.user.disabled?
+    return if @me.user.disabled? || @status.nil?
 
     locale_for_account(@me) do
       thread_by_conversation(@status.conversation)
@@ -33,7 +33,7 @@ class NotificationMailer < ApplicationMailer
     @account = notification.from_account
     @status  = notification.target_status
 
-    return if @me.user.disabled?
+    return if @me.user.disabled? || @status.nil?
 
     locale_for_account(@me) do
       thread_by_conversation(@status.conversation)
@@ -46,7 +46,7 @@ class NotificationMailer < ApplicationMailer
     @account = notification.from_account
     @status  = notification.target_status
 
-    return if @me.user.disabled?
+    return if @me.user.disabled? || @status.nil?
 
     locale_for_account(@me) do
       thread_by_conversation(@status.conversation)